Originally Posted by Bill D
I’m wondering if the seats might be a good candidate for the Leatherique twins
You think? It would be interesting to try it out. I don’t have any experience with it but TBO I’ve never really found much interest in it. There’s many ways to skin that cat and once it’s skinned it’s pretty much skinned.
A method either gets dirty leather clean of it doesn’t.. And the whole making it soft and supple concept sort of contradicts the whole “you can’t condition leather” argument that seems to be near gospel these days, except in regards to Leatherique, and I’ve never understood why it seems to be the only “leather conditioner” that gets a pass.
